Bio

After finishing in the top ten at four different World Junior Championships (2002, 2003, 2004, and 2005), Mari joined the elite ranks by competing in her first World Cup in 2005 as well as the Commonwealth Games in 2006 and Beijing Olympic Games in 2008. In 2008 she also finished 3rd in the U23 World Championships becoming the first and only African to medal at a ITU Triathlon Elite World Championship.

Mari won the very prestigious academic scholarship, a Rhodes Scholarship in 2010 to study at Oxford University. She completed her MSc in Applied Statistics in 2011 and MBA in 2013.

In December 2015 she joined Darren Smith’s squad and since then has had a number of successful races including securing 11th place at the 2016 Rio de Janeiro Olympic Games.
